Abstract
It is widely accepted that bacteriorhodopsin undergoes global conformationa l changes during its photocycle. In this review, the structural properties of the M and N intermediates are described in detail. Based on the clarifie d global conformational change, we propose a model for the molecular mechan ism of the proton pump. The global structural change is suggested to be a k ey component in establishing vectorial proton transport. (C) 2000 Elsevier Science B.V. All rights reserved.
